Sunil Mohan Adapa 75f6abac1e
*: Make setup method part of App class for all apps
- Primary purpose is to complete the App API and allow for multiple apps to be
present in a module without a single clashing setup() method. Secondary
objective is to get rid of SetupHelper instance simple use App instance instead.

- This brings us closer to not needing to implement setup() method for some of
the typical apps.

- Remove default value None for old_version parameter.

  - A valid integer value is always passed to this call.

  - The value of None is undefined.

  - Simplifies the App API slightly.

- Drop setting 'pre', 'post' values to indicate the stage of setup for the App.

  - Simplifies the setup methods significantly. Eliminates a class of
  bugs (some of them seen earlier).

  - The UI can show a simple 'installing...' or progress spinner instead of
  individual stages.

  - There are currently many inconsistencies where many operations are not
  wrapped in helper.call() calls.

# SPDX-License-Identifier: AGPL-3.0-or-later
"""
FreedomBox app for calibre e-book library.
"""
import json
import re
from django.utils.translation import gettext_lazy as _
from plinth import actions
from plinth import app as app_module
from plinth import cfg, frontpage, menu
from plinth.daemon import Daemon
from plinth.modules.apache.components import Webserver
from plinth.modules.backups.components import BackupRestore
from plinth.modules.firewall.components import Firewall
from plinth.modules.users.components import UsersAndGroups
from plinth.package import Packages
from plinth.utils import format_lazy
from . import manifest
_description = [
format_lazy(
_('calibre server provides online access to your e-book collection. '
'You can store your e-books on your {box_name}, read them online or '
'from any of your devices.'), box_name=_(cfg.box_name)),
_('You can organize your e-books, extract and edit their metadata, and '
'perform advanced search. calibre can import, export, or convert across '
'a wide range of formats to make e-books ready for reading on any '
'device. It also provides an online web reader. It remembers your '
'last read location, bookmarks, and highlighted text. Content '
'distribution using OPDS is currently not supported.'),
_('Only users belonging to <em>calibre</em> group will be able to access '
'the app. All users with access can use all the libraries.')
]
app = None
LIBRARY_NAME_PATTERN = r'[a-zA-Z0-9 _-]+'
class CalibreApp(app_module.App):
"""FreedomBox app for calibre."""
app_id = 'calibre'
_version = 1
DAEMON = 'calibre-server-freedombox'
def __init__(self):
"""Create components for the app."""
super().__init__()
groups = {'calibre': _('Use calibre e-book libraries')}
info = app_module.Info(app_id=self.app_id, version=self._version,
name=_('calibre'), icon_filename='calibre',
short_description=_('E-book Library'),
description=_description, manual_page='Calibre',
clients=manifest.clients,
donation_url='https://calibre-ebook.com/donate')
self.add(info)
menu_item = menu.Menu('menu-calibre', info.name,
info.short_description, info.icon_filename,
'calibre:index', parent_url_name='apps')
self.add(menu_item)
shortcut = frontpage.Shortcut('shortcut-calibre', info.name,
short_description=info.short_description,
icon=info.icon_filename, url='/calibre',
clients=info.clients,
login_required=True,
allowed_groups=list(groups))
self.add(shortcut)
packages = Packages('packages-calibre', ['calibre'])
self.add(packages)
firewall = Firewall('firewall-calibre', info.name,
ports=['http', 'https'], is_external=True)
self.add(firewall)
webserver = Webserver('webserver-calibre', 'calibre-freedombox',
urls=['https://{host}/calibre'])
self.add(webserver)
daemon = Daemon('daemon-calibre', self.DAEMON,
listen_ports=[(8844, 'tcp4')])
self.add(daemon)
users_and_groups = UsersAndGroups('users-and-groups-calibre',
reserved_usernames=['calibre'],
groups=groups)
self.add(users_and_groups)
backup_restore = BackupRestore('backup-restore-calibre',
**manifest.backup)
self.add(backup_restore)
def setup(self, old_version):
"""Install and configure the app."""
super().setup(old_version)
self.enable()
def validate_library_name(library_name):
"""Raise exception if library name does not fit the accepted pattern."""
if not re.fullmatch(r'[A-Za-z0-9_.-]+', library_name):
raise Exception('Invalid library name')
def list_libraries():
"""Return a list of libraries."""
output = actions.superuser_run('calibre', ['list-libraries'])
return json.loads(output)['libraries']
def create_library(name):
"""Create an empty library."""
actions.superuser_run('calibre', ['create-library', name])
actions.superuser_run('service', ['try-restart', CalibreApp.DAEMON])
def delete_library(name):
"""Delete a library and its contents."""
actions.superuser_run('calibre', ['delete-library', name])
actions.superuser_run('service', ['try-restart', CalibreApp.DAEMON])
